Support Beams: A Vital Component for Load-Bearing Walls

Support beams are critical structural elements that play a crucial role in the stability and integrity of load-bearing walls. By providing additional support, they ensure that the walls can effectively carry the weight of the structure above, preventing potential damage or collapse.

Benefits of Support Beams for Load-Bearing Walls

  • Increased Load Capacity: Support beams significantly increase the load-bearing capacity of walls, allowing them to support heavier loads and larger structures.

  • Structural Integrity: They provide stability and structural integrity to walls, preventing bowing, cracking, or collapse under excessive weight.

  • Cost-Effective Solution: Support beams are a cost-effective way to reinforce load-bearing walls, avoiding the need for more expensive structural modifications.

How to Install Support Beams for Load-Bearing Walls

1. Determine the Load Requirements: Consult with a structural engineer to determine the required load capacity and design of the support beam.

2. Plan the Installation: Mark the location of the support beam and determine the necessary supports.

3. Install the Supports: Install temporary supports to hold the existing wall in place while the support beam is installed.

4. Position the Support Beam: Carefully position the support beam onto the supports and secure it with appropriate fasteners.

Common Mistakes to Avoid

  • Underestimating Load Capacity: Using a support beam with insufficient load capacity can lead to structural failure.

  • Improper Installation: Incorrectly installing the support beam can compromise its effectiveness and cause safety concerns.

  • Neglecting Wall Reinforcements: Failing to connect the wall to the support beam can result in the wall continuing to deteriorate.
